A delicate, handwritten script with tall, slender proportions and pronounced contrast between hairline connectors and slightly heavier downstrokes. Letterforms are upright with narrow bowls, long ascenders/descenders, and frequent loops on capitals and select lowercase. Strokes taper to fine terminals, giving an airy texture, while spacing remains open enough for individual letter shapes to read clearly even when connections appear in running text. Numerals follow the same light, calligraphic construction with thin curves and modest swells.
Well-suited to wedding suites, greeting cards, and invitation work where a light, elegant script is desired. It can also support boutique branding, cosmetics or confectionery packaging, and short pull quotes or headings where its flourishes can be featured without sacrificing clarity.
The overall tone is graceful and lightly fanciful, with a poised, boutique feel. Its looping capitals and fine lines convey a romantic, personal voice—more “handwritten note” than formal engraving—while staying clean and composed.
The design appears intended to mimic a neat, contemporary calligraphy hand with restrained connections and decorative, looped capitals. It prioritizes elegance and a personal, crafted impression through high contrast, tall proportions, and fine terminal work.
Capitals are notably expressive, with extended entry/exit strokes and occasional flourished crossings that add movement across a line. The very fine hairlines suggest it will appear most crisp at moderate-to-large sizes or in high-resolution output where the delicate details can hold.
